Hundreds of mourners have paid their respects to slain rapper Dolla, who was buried in a traditional Muslim ceremony on Saturday.
The 21-year-old rising star, real name Roderick Anthony Burton II, was shot in the head outside L.A.'s Beverly Center mall on Monday. He died later that day in hospital.
Family, friends and fans gathered for the funeral at the Word of Faith Love Center in Dolla's hometown of Atlanta, Georgia on Saturday afternoon to pay tribute to the late star, according to Allhiphop.com.
The traditional burial ceremony came after a small, private wake on Friday which was held at a funeral home in the city and attended by stars including Dolla's Konvict Muzik labelmate Ray Lavender and Smallville actor Sam Jones III.
Aubrey Berry, 23, from Atlanta, Georgia, has pleaded not guilty to the hip-hop star's murder and remains in custody on $5 million bail.
